Gerry Larsson is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Clinical Psychology and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management. According to data from OpenAlex, Gerry Larsson has authored 213 papers receiving a total of 4.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 79 papers in General Health Professions, 47 papers in Clinical Psychology and 40 papers in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management. Recurrent topics in Gerry Larsson’s work include Health, psychology, and well-being (25 papers), Job Satisfaction and Organizational Behavior (24 papers) and Patient Satisfaction in Healthcare (20 papers). Gerry Larsson is often cited by papers focused on Health, psychology, and well-being (25 papers), Job Satisfaction and Organizational Behavior (24 papers) and Patient Satisfaction in Healthcare (20 papers). Gerry Larsson collaborates with scholars based in Sweden, Norway and United States. Gerry Larsson's co-authors include Bodil Wilde‐Larsson, Bengt Starrin, Bodil Wilde, Sven Setterlind, Rolf Zetterström, Jarle Eid, Louise von Essén, Kjell Kallenberg, Kjell Öberg and Marie‐Louise Hall‐Lord and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Applied Psychology, Social Science & Medicine and American Journal of Obstetrics and Gynecology.
